Real Madrid are signing new players and also renewing those they believe will continue to add value. Thibaut Courtois is obviously one of those names, and his contract extension is only a matter of time.

But one contract decision by Los Blancos has puzzled fans. According to Fabrizio Romano, Madrid are very close to agreeing on a new contract for Brahim Díaz. But the question is: why?

Romano says that the player has already agreed to stay and extend, but his future at Madrid looks meek at best. He had interest from Liverpool and he can better minutes there.

He may not get the chances he needs to shine. He didn’t get many of them last season either.

Brahim is inconsistent and renewing his contract makes little sense

It is an apparent fact that Brahim is not the finest right wing option right now. He was very unreliable last season and cost Madrid the Copa Del Rey victory in the final against Barcelona.

Even when given chances, he fails to perform. Arda Guler is certainly superior to him at the position, and Xabi may even give the Turkish youngster first preference.

Furthermore, the signing of Franco Mastantuono eliminates Brahim's opportunity to play regular minutes. Mastantuono will start frequently and always ahead of Brahim.

And, despite his particularly poor performance, I feel Rodrygo deserves to be chosen ahead of Brahim. Rodrygo  is inventive and can be a good player on his best days, but Brahim hasn't demonstrated any of that lately.

Unless Xabi is planning to keep a lot of backups or play different teams for different competitions, like Zinedine Zidane did back in the day, this renewal makes very little sense - especially for the player himself.
